We know that plastic weighs heavily on the environment.

Many synthetic materials used in footwear and apparel, like polyester and TPU, are considered plastic, which means that discarded gear can remain in landfills for far too long.

Because of this, we’re trying to minimize our footprint by using less virgin plastic and more recycled, natural, or other eco-friendly materials wherever possible.

The way we make things matters as much as what’s in them.

By ensuring our high performance and durability standards, you can use our products for a good long time, and even extend their life by repurposing them for other activities or donating when you’re done with them.

Our membership in the Sustainable Apparel Coalition — the apparel, footwear, and textile industry’s leading alliance for sustainable production — helps us use data to address inefficiencies, improve sustainability performance, and achieve the transparency we know is important to you.

First impressions are everything.

Our teams have been working to incorporate more sustainable and recycled content into everything from our hangtags to our shoeboxes, all so that what’s on the outside is as good as what’s inside.

Because we know there’s strength in numbers, we’ve joined prAna’s Responsible Packaging Movement to accelerate the work we’re doing to create less wasteful, lower-impact packaging for both consumer goods and production samples.
